What companies run services between East Dulwich, England and Cannon Street Station, England?

Southern operates a train from East Dulwich to London Bridge every 20 minutes. Tickets cost £2–5 and the journey takes 13 min. Alternatively, Go Ahead London operates a bus from North Cross Road to Blackfriars Station / North Entrance every 10 minutes. Tickets cost £1–25 and the journey takes 40 min.
